Schedule

As noted, The Hanford Site Manhattan Project and Cold War Era Historic District Final Treatment Report is scheduled for completion on September 30, 2000. To achieve this objective, the work will be partitioned over a 4-year period (see Table A.8 in Appendix A).

FY 1997

During fiscal year 1997 (October 1, 1996 to September 30, 1997), draft sections of Chapter 2 will be written to cover Construction History, Plutonium Finishing, Reactor Operations, and Worker History. Twenty-nine (29) ExHPIFs and 29 HPIFs will be completed. In determining which specific properties will be documented, first consideration will be given to those buildings and structures scheduled for demolition during FY1997. Consideration will then be given to those that will undergo house cleaning in preparation for demolition. Consideration will next be given to properties associated with the historic narratives being written. Should these criteria result in the selection of fewer properties than necessary to meet the yearly objective, additional properties will be selected in FY1998, again based on needs.

FY 1998

During FY1998, draft sections of Chapter 2 will be written to cover Chemical Separations, Health and Safety, Site Security, and Infrastructure (Transportation, Communication, and General Site Support). Chapter 4 will also be drafted following public outreach and receipt of comments as discussed above. Seven ExHPIFs and 60 HPIFs will be completed utilizing the criteria discussed above. The HAER documentation for 105-B will be completed. Draft Chapters and site forms from FY1997 will be distributed through established DOE-RL public involvement procedures for comment.

FY 1999

During FY1999, draft sections of Chapter 2 will be written to cover Military Operations, Research and Development, and Waste Management. Twelve ExHPIFs and 24 HPIFs will be completed. The HAER documentation for 221-T will be completed. Draft materials from FY1998 will be distributed for public comment.

FY 2000

During fiscal year 2000, Chapter 1 will be drafted. The draft section on Fuel Manufacturing will be written to complete Chapter 2. Chapter 3 will be compiled from sources developed to date. Nine ExHPIFs will be completed. The HAER documentation for 313 will be completed. Draft materials from FY1999 will be distributed for public comment. The initial draft of the Treatment Report will be prepared.

FY 2001

Draft Treatment Report will be distributed for public comment. Final Treatment Report will be printed and distributed.
